Home > JMC > 2001 > ReviewTaken August 2001 from London Gatwick to AlicanteOverall a pleasant flight. Friendly crew, nice meals (their main meals like chicken, beef etc. Their breakfast's are a bit disgusting). However you have to pay for drinks (reasonable prices however), but the main problem as always for a charter airline is the amount of legroom. I am only 15 years old and found the legroom very short. I wouldn't imagine what flying to U.S.A would be like! It's a shame about airlines not making room for the comfort of passengers. Instead of people risking their lives with DVT airlines want to save a bit of money! Outbound flight was delayed by 1 hour, but the return flight was 5 minutes early. Overall a good flight for the amount of money. | ||
